Despite a 2.35 ERA this spring, Perkins has had lower velocity. He threw 91 to 93 mph while throwing a scoreless inning in Wednesday's spring training game, the Minneapolis Star Tribune's LaVelle Neal reports. He averaged 93.7 mph on fastballs last season. "I will be right where I need to be once the season starts and as we get going," he said.
Perkins' lower velocity could just be a case of a veteran tinkering with his pitches or ramping up slowly, but it's not a reassuring sign after he's broken down in the second half the past two seasons. Perkins is set in the closer role with Kevin Jepsen as his primary setup man.
